초록

To diagnosis abnormal compressor conditions in an air-conditioner, the acoustic emission (AE) signal, which is derived from wear condition, compressed air, and assembly error, was analyzed experimentally. Burst and continuous type AE signals resulted from metal contact and compressed air, and the raw AE signal of compressors was acquired in the production line. After extracting samples using waveforms, the Early Life Test (ELT) was conducted and the waveform was classified as normal or abnormal. Efficient parameters in the waveform pattern were investigated in time and frequency domains and a diagnosis algorithm for air-conditioners using Neural Network estimation is suggested.
